Solution Overview

Problem

Current wellsite operations face challenges in optimizing production rates and minimizing intake pressure for subsurface fluids using traditional artificial lift techniques, as they often require extensive data and complex calculations to determine optimal pumping parameters.

Innovation Solution

A jet pump system comprising a surface pump, a pump driver, and sensors that measure and adjust pumping parameters such as drive frequency and power fluid flow rate to optimize production by minimizing pump intake pressure and maximizing liquid production rate, using real-time data and inflow performance relationships.

AI summary

A jet pump system and method facilitate the production of a subterranean fluid. The jet pump system comprises a jet pump, a surface pump, a surface pump gauge, and a pump driver coupled to the surface pump to change a drive frequency of the pump driver based on production parameters and pumping parameters of the surface pump (drive frequency (FR) of the surface pump and the power fluid parameters) whereby the surface pump is selectively varied to optimize production. The jet pump method involves deploying the jet pump into the wellbore; pumping power fluid through the jet pump using the surface pump; measuring the pumping parameters; generating the production parameters of the subterranean fluid produced (production rate (QP) of the subterranean fluid); and optimizing the producing by changing the drive frequency (FR) based on the measured power fluid parameters and the generated production parameters.
